Background
RNF Group, established in 1996 and headquartered in Drunen, Netherlands, is a prominent entity in the footwear and apparel industry. The company is dedicated to designing and distributing a diverse range of shoes and clothing, aiming to deliver high-quality products that resonate with contemporary fashion trends. RNF Group's portfolio includes renowned brands such as Mexx, Fred de la Bretonière, and Shabbies. Additionally, the company holds licenses for the development and production of brands like Umbro and Pantofola d'Oro.

Financials and Funding
While specific financial details are not publicly disclosed, RNF Group has demonstrated growth through strategic acquisitions. Notably, in March 2019, the company acquired Fred de la Bretonière, a designer of leather bags, belts, and sandals, based in Hertogenbosch, Netherlands. This acquisition marked RNF Group's entry into the apparel and textiles sector, expanding its product offerings and market reach.

Leadership Changes
In December 2024, RNF Group was acquired by HVEG Fashion Group, a move that aligns with both companies' growth strategies. Following the acquisition, Ron Janssen and Ferry Helmer remained as shareholders and part of the management team, ensuring continuity in leadership and strategic direction.
